How to Choose the Perfect Massage for Managing Stress?
How can one effectively select the ideal massage for stress relief? To begin, you should determine personal stress triggers and preferences. Deep tissue massage, for example, targets tense muscles and may be helpful for those experiencing chronic stress or pain. Conversely, a Swedish massage offers a softer touch, promoting relaxation through light strokes and kneading.
Next, people should evaluate the massage atmosphere. A peaceful space improves the session, promoting an atmosphere conducive to relaxation. It is also essential to converse openly with the massage therapist about individual needs and areas of concern, ensuring a personalized approach.
In conclusion, investigating various techniques, such as aromatherapy or hot stone massages, can improve the overall experience. By understanding personal needs, the environment, and available techniques, one can with confidence choose the right massage to reach ideal stress relief, eventually renewing both mind and body.

Body Care Treatments: Wraps & Body Scrubs
Spa services go beyond facial treatments, providing a variety of body treatments that boost both skin health and overall relaxation. Among these, body wraps and scrubs stand out as popular options. Body scrubs usually use exfoliating ingredients, such as sea salt or sugar, to strip away dead skin cells, leaving the skin rejuvenated and smooth. This process not only enhances skin texture but also promotes circulation, leading to a healthier appearance.
Conversely, body wraps frequently incorporate beneficial ingredients including mud, algae, or essential oils. These wraps encompass the body, enabling the skin to absorb beneficial nutrients while enhancing hydration. The heat created during the treatment additionally helps with detoxification and relaxation. Together, wraps and scrubs establish a comprehensive approach to body care, addressing both aesthetic and wellness needs. As clients enjoy these treatments, they feel a deep sense of relaxation, making body treatments an important part of any spa experience.

Exploring Hydrotherapy Techniques
Although countless people look for relaxation through aromatherapy, hydrotherapy delivers a complementary approach that utilizes water's therapeutic properties for rejuvenation. This practice encompasses multiple methods, including warm baths, steam treatments, and underwater massages. Each method targets specific concerns, such as stress relief, improved circulation, and muscle relaxation.
Heated water immersion calms tight muscles, while steam therapy facilitates detoxification through sweating. Hydrotherapy pools typically incorporate jets for focused massage, enhancing the overall experience. Additionally, contrast hydrotherapy—alternating between warm and cold water—stimulates circulation and revitalizes the body.

What Clothing Should I Bring to My Spa Appointment?
Visitors should wear comfortable, loose-fitting clothing to their spa visit. Numerous spas offer robes and slippers, enabling guests to rest fully. It's recommended to skip heavy makeup and jewelry for an perfect experience.
Can Pregnant Women Safely Receive Spa Treatments?
Spa treatments can be safe for pregnant women, provided they choose appropriate services. Speaking with a medical professional in advance ensures the treatments are appropriate, avoiding any procedures that may pose risks to both mother and baby.
How Much Time Do Spa Treatments Usually Take?
Spa services generally run between thirty minutes to a couple of hours, according to the nature of the procedure. Variables including the complexity of the treatment and the facility's services can impact the time span of each visit.
Am I Permitted to Bring My Own Products to the Spa?
Most spa facilities allow clients to bring personal products, but policies can vary. It's recommended to verify with the spa in advance to ensure that personal items are allowed and compatible with their treatment protocols.
What Are the Rules for Tipping at a Spa?
Usually, tipping at a spa ranges from 15% to 20% of the total service fee, relative to service satisfaction. It is customary to tip individual therapists, not the front desk staff, for their personalized service.
